Food banks and pantries in Alachua County are facing more challenges than usual this season thanks to a rise in the price of groceries, the aftermath of Hurricane Ian and an increase in demand.

Hundreds gathered for Farm Share's collaborative event with the Alachua County Christian Pastors Association Wednesday morning, and the food ran out well before the planned end-time. Commuters traveled from other counties into Gainesville and flooded Waldo Road with traffic.
